If pfsense is managing your dhcp, try setting the RAX120 up in access point mode. It prevents a double nat.

Hello
Currently I am using both
- PFSENSE with DHCP Service and then allowing only one dedicated IP Address to the Netgear router.
- The routeur is plugged directly on the Firewall on the ethernet port.
When, the wifi netgear router is plugged directly on the box (fibre modem) then no problem for routeur, the interface status is showing connected to internet and also the traffic is working.
But, when behind the firewall pfsense, then the router interface status is showing not connected to internet.
Nevertheless, devices connected in Wifi can access to internet.
When I look on logs firewall, I saw that the router try to contact public ip address with ICMP protocol.
Maybe to get the status of the Internet connection.
Then my question, does the router need specific rules to communicate with Internet ?
Thanks
PS : currently the router is configured as router, not in access point mode.
